    Cosco shipping lines has celebrated the inaugural voyage of its WSA5 service to Colombia’s Port of Buenaventura with a series of festivities held at the SPRB terminal in Buenaventura.

    At the ceremony, COSCO SHIPPING’s MV Xin Hong Kong delivered 707 TEU of goods from China, including automobiles, photovoltaics, major appliances, and small commodities.

    The WSA5 route links major domestic ports with numerous key ports along Western South America’s coast, ensuring efficient logistics connectivity.

    The route covers several significant ports on the west coast of South America, including those in Mexico, Colombia, Ecuador, and Peru’s Chancay Port, thereby catering to a diverse range of transportation needs.

    Counselor Gao Jinbao from the Economic and Commercial Counselor’s Office of the Chinese Embassy in Colombia and Ligia del Carmen Córdoba Martinez, the Mayor of Buenaventura, were among the dignitaries invited to attend.

    Nearly 200 representatives from local government departments, industry associations, and businesses from both countries were present at the event.
